Ohio's surplus revenue share eyed by legislature
The Greene County Gazette notes Ohio's share of the national surplus revenue, about 3.29 million dollars, and debates uses including debt relief, education funding, and internal improvements. Editorials urge equitable distribution among counties, cautious canal projects, and protection against partisan influences.
